How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 48036?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
48036 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,218 | $795 | $3,344 |
48036 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,394 | $885 | $2,628 |
48036 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,106 | $1,210 | $3,245 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Senior the 48036 ZIP Code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Senior 48036 Apartment?
The average rent for a Senior Apartment in 48036 is $1,805.
What is the largest Senior 48036 Apartment for rent?
Today's Senior apartment with the most square footage in 48036 is a 825 square feet unit starting from $1,705 at New Hartford Square Senior Apartments.
What is the average size for 48036 Senior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Senior rental in 48036 is currently at 625 sq ft.
